Speaking of my makeup kit, Friday I finally bought a train case. What is a train case? This is basically a suitcase to carry my makeup and tools to gigs. I lucked out and found one I like (for now) at Ulta. It was on sale for $33.75 and I used a $5 off coupon to get it for only $30 after taxes. Sweet!!
